About
Yoruhana borrows its structure from old-school JRPGs rather than the usual visual novel format, running on isometric pixel art with hand-drawn illustrations layered in for the important moments. Choices branch the story as you go, and the whole thing plays more like an actual game than a click-through.
Bella and her friends are on their way to a party in Blumenschaft, a town that's stranger than the invitation suggested. The trip becomes an excuse to meet the people living there, and what happens between them along the way.
You move Bella through the world with a controller or keyboard, picking dialogue that shapes where the story goes rather than just watching it unfold. Every line of dialogue has optional Japanese voice acting, which does a lot of the heavy lifting for tone even when the text stays restrained.
